This used to be my job. They're not controlling the cars. They're basically completing real-time CAPTCHAs, telling the car whether the cameras see a stop sign, a bicycle, temporary barriers, etc. If the car can't identify an object that could possibly cross its path, it pulls over and stops until an operator can do a sanity-check on whatever the car's confused by. They only need to be able to identify objects on the road, not know the rules of the road.
No. They just end the ride and send somebody from the local depot to drive the car back to the garage.
Source: I was on Waymo's Fleet Response team for a year doing literally this job that is now outsourced overseas. While the tech exists for full remote steering, NHTSA regulations disallow it, and that's one of the few agencies that Google actually has to abide by if they want to drive their cars on public roads.
